Why GPU Temperature Matters
Every graphics card produces heat while processing millions of calculations every second. The harder the GPU works, the more electrical power it consumes, and the more heat it generates.
The rtx 5080 gaming PC UAE is built with advanced cooling technology, but it still depends on good airflow inside the computer case. If heat cannot escape efficiently, internal temperatures rise, causing the graphics card and other components to work harder.
Keeping temperatures under control provides several important benefits:

Modern GPUs automatically protect themselves from dangerous temperatures by reducing clock speeds. While this prevents permanent damage, it can also lower gaming performance.
What Is a Normal Temperature for an RTX 5080?
Normal temperatures depend on what your computer is doing.
When your rtx 5080 gaming PC UAE is sitting on the desktop or browsing the internet, the graphics card performs very little work. During gaming or rendering, however, the GPU operates near its maximum capacity.
Typical temperature ranges include:
| Usage | Normal Temperature |
|---|---|
| Idle | 30°C–45°C |
| Light tasks | 35°C–55°C |
| Gaming | 60°C–75°C |
| Heavy AAA gaming | 70°C–80°C |
| Rendering or AI workloads | 70°C–82°C |
| Maximum safe operating range | Up to around 85°C |
These numbers can vary slightly depending on the graphics card model, room temperature, cooling solution, and airflow.
Why UAE Climate Affects Gaming PC Temperatures
One major factor affecting the rtx 5080 gaming PC UAE is the environment.
The UAE experiences high outdoor temperatures for much of the year. Even indoors, room temperatures can be warmer than in many other countries, especially if air conditioning is not running continuously.
Since computer cooling depends on the surrounding air, warmer rooms naturally lead to higher component temperatures.
For example:
-
Room at 20°C
-
GPU during gaming: 68°C
Now consider:
-
Room at 30°C
-
Same workload
-
GPU temperature may increase to around 78°C
Nothing is wrong with the graphics card. The cooling system simply has warmer air available for removing heat.
This is why gamers in the UAE often benefit from strong case airflow and efficient cooling systems.
Idle Temperatures Explained
Idle temperature refers to the GPU temperature when very little work is being performed.
If your rtx 5080 gaming PC UAE is simply displaying Windows, checking emails, or streaming music, temperatures should generally remain between 30°C and 45°C.
Some graphics cards include a Zero RPM mode.
In this feature:
-
Fans stop completely.
-
Noise is eliminated.
-
Temperature slowly rises.
-
Fans automatically restart once the GPU reaches a preset temperature.
Seeing your GPU idle at around 45°C with fans turned off is perfectly normal.

Understanding GPU Hot Spot Temperature
Modern graphics cards measure multiple temperatures.
The main GPU temperature is only one reading.
Another important value is the Hot Spot temperature.
The Hot Spot measures the hottest area inside the graphics chip.
For example:
GPU Temperature:
72°C
Hot Spot:
86°C
This difference is completely normal.
Hot Spot temperatures are usually 10°C–20°C higher than the average GPU temperature.
Many users panic after seeing a Hot Spot value above 90°C, but manufacturers expect localized hot areas during heavy workloads.
Memory Temperature
The graphics memory also produces heat.
High-speed GDDR memory chips become warm during:
-
4K gaming
-
8K gaming
-
Video rendering
-
AI workloads
-
Texture-heavy games
Memory temperatures are often higher than GPU core temperatures.
Efficient cooling plates and thermal pads help transfer heat away from these chips.

What Causes Higher GPU Temperatures?
Several factors affect temperatures.
The most common include:
Room Temperature
Warmer rooms naturally increase GPU temperatures.
Airflow
Poor airflow traps hot air inside the computer case.
Dust
Dust blocks cooling fins and reduces airflow.
Fan Curves
Quiet fan settings often allow temperatures to climb higher before increasing fan speed.
Overclocking
Increasing GPU frequency raises power consumption and heat.
Power Limit
Higher power limits allow the graphics card to consume more electricity, producing additional heat.
Case Design
Compact computer cases generally have less airflow than larger cases.
How Airflow Keeps Temperatures Low
Airflow is one of the most overlooked aspects of building a gaming PC.
A balanced airflow setup removes hot air before it accumulates.
Most gaming systems benefit from:
-
Front intake fans
-
Bottom intake fans (if supported)
-
Rear exhaust fan
-
Top exhaust fans
Cool air enters from the front while warm air exits through the rear and top.
This creates continuous airflow throughout the case.

Choosing the Right PC Case
Not every computer case cools equally well.
A modern airflow-focused case includes:
-
Mesh front panel
-
Multiple fan mounting locations
-
Cable management space
-
Large ventilation openings
-
Dust filters
Restricted airflow cases with solid front panels may increase GPU temperatures by several degrees.
Even powerful cooling fans cannot compensate for poor case ventilation.

Air Cooling vs Liquid Cooling
Many new PC builders assume liquid cooling directly cools the graphics card.
In reality, most liquid coolers cool only the CPU.
The GPU continues using its own cooling fans.
However, a liquid-cooled CPU indirectly helps because it reduces heat inside the computer case.
Benefits of CPU liquid cooling include:
-
Lower CPU temperatures
-
Less heat near the graphics card
-
Better internal airflow
-
Reduced overall case temperature
Meanwhile, quality air coolers also provide excellent CPU performance while costing less.
For most gamers, either solution works well when combined with good airflow.
